Software researchers have discovered multiple pieces of code directly related to foldable hardware within the system, indicating that the software foundation for Apple's first foldable iPhone has quietly been established. Code researchers found several key strings in the internal version of iOS 27, including "foldState" for identifying the device's folded or unfolded status, as well as "mechanicalAngleDegrees" and "angleDegrees," which can detect the hinge's unfolding angle. These codes did not appear in iOS 26 and are seen as the most direct evidence of Apple's upcoming foldable device. The new features in iOS 27 also reveal the design intentions for foldable screens. The system's newly added full-page widget format supports applications like music and news to occupy the entire main screen, a design that will be particularly useful on a foldable iPhone with a larger inner screen. Additionally, the update to the iPhone mirroring feature in macOS 27 allows connected iPhones to be adjusted to an iPad-sized layout, aligning with rumors that the foldable device will be close to the size of an iPad mini when unfolded. Apple also clearly stated in its developer presentation that the design targets for developers in the future "will no longer be specific devices and screen orientations, but rather dynamically changing sizes and aspect ratios." This statement directly echoes the characteristic of foldable screens needing to present different interfaces in two states. Bloomberg reports that Apple's first foldable iPhone is expected to debut alongside the iPhone 18 Pro series in September this year, with a starting price of around $2000.
